About Achim J. Lilienthal
Achim J. Lilienthal is a scholar working on Insect Science,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ition and Geology, having authored 259 papers that have together received 6.5k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Insect Pheromone Research and Control (90 papers), Advanced Chemical Sensor Technologies (81 papers) and Robotics and Sensor-Based Localization (77 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Insect Science (1.9k citations), Geology (827 citations) and Aerospace Engineering (2.6k citations). Achim J. Lilienthal has collaborated with scholars based in Sweden, Germany and Spain. Frequent co-authors include Tom Duckett, Martin Magnusson, Henrik Andreasson, Todor Stoyanov, Victor Hernandez Bennetts, Marco Trincavelli, Jari Saarinen, Patrick P. Neumann, Maike Schindler and Matteo Reggente.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, IEEE Access and Sensors.
